What Does the Name Graham Mean?

Graham comes from the Scottish surname meaning gravelly homestead or grey home, originally from Grantham in England. Alexander Graham Bell invented the telephone. Graham Greene (novelist), Graham Norton (TV host), Graham Nash (musician). Top 175 US, top 50 in Scotland and the UK. Two syllables, refined Scottish elegance with intellectual heritage.
